Ice hockey: Mannheim wins top game at the Eisbären

Two days after the 2:6 home defeat against Cologne, the Adler Mannheim have rehabilitated themselves with a victory in the top game at the Eisbären Berlin.Coach Sean Simpson’s team won 4-3 (2-1,1-1,1-1,1-1) in the capital city and equalled the polar bears on points.

With an overpaid hit in 52nd grade.In the ninth minute, Garrett Festerling made the guests’ victory perfect in front of 12,877 spectators.

Meanwhile, the Düsseldorf-based EC confirmed its upward trend.After scoring 6:4 against Red Bull Munich on Friday, the eight-time German champion clinched a 5:1 (3:1,1:0,1:1) victory over Iserlohn Roosters.The man of the match was Alexei Dmitryev, who scored three times.

The spectators witnessed a thrilling fight in the Berlin Mercedes-Benz Arena.After the Mannheim 2-0 lead by Marcel Goc and Phil Hungerecker, the polar bears were balanced by Daniel Fischbuch and Nicholas Petersen.The 3:2 of the eagle by Chad Kolarik, James Sheppard made up for it with the 3:3.Festerling finally made the decision.
